Beambrücken
Beambrücken, also known as beam bridges, are the simplest and most common type of bridge. They consist of horizontal beams supported at each end by abutments, piers, or other bridges. The beams carry the load of the bridge deck and any traffic passing over it, transferring that load to the supports.
